ADMINISTRATIVE COMMENTS:

 

The subject property at 151 Elm Street previously contained a laundromat which has been demolished. The property is under the same ownership and adjacent to 170 West Main Street, where a three-story mixed-use building is currently under construction.  The applicant envisions future development of this site, possibly including parking for the mixed-use structure at 170 W. Main Street.  To further that development, the owner is requesting to rezone the property from General Business District (GB) to Old Town Center District (OTC).  The proposed OTC zoning is in compliance with the 2003 Old Town Master Plan. The Planning and Zoning Commission recommended unanimous approval (7-0) on February 5, 2019.
